Monmouth Medical Center (MMC) is one of New Jersey’s largest community teaching hospitals, where physicians and employees work as a team dedicated to academic and clinical excellence and comprehensive, compassionate patient care. As part of RWJ Barnabas Health, Monmouth Medical Center is a leader in designing unparalleled new ways for delivering health care.
For over 130years, Monmouth Medical Center has been the leader in central New Jersey in providing the best in health care and the latest in medical technology to nearly 1 million residents that comprise its primary service area of Monmouth County, and portions of Ocean and Middlesex counties. Monmouth Medical Center is recognized as a Top Teaching Hospital by The Leapfrog Group, which is widely acknowledged and underscores the highest commitment to patient safety and quality. MMC is the only hospital in Monmouth and Ocean counties to receive an A Hospital Safety Score by The Leapfrog Group, the nation s leading experts on patient safety, for six consecutive rating periods. We continue to lead the system in HCAHPS scores, and are looked to as a model for best practice in patient satisfaction.
SUMMARY OF JOB FUNCTION:
- Evaluate all hematology patients
- Work with families
- Advocates for the special needs of children and their families,
- Helping children and their families process and cope with medical situations,
- Medical play,
- Providing information, support, and guidance to parents and family members,
JOB REQUIREMENTS:
- Masters Degree with a Child Life certificate or qualified to take the exam
- BA/BS Degree. Area of concentration: Child Life, Child Development Education, Creative Arts Therapies, etc. Academic preparation at Bachelor s level with experience in a health care setting. Prefer one-year experience in a Child Life Program setting.
- Coursework in Child Life, Human Development, Family Dynamics, Psychology, Sociology, Counseling, Therapeutic Recreation, and/or Expressive Therapies preferred.
- Clinical Internship experience preferred
